Weather patterns change year to year in the mountains. Third season can be warm and dry or wet and snowy depending on the year. Although colder snowier weather would be more the norm in the later seasons. Expect some snow but probably not a ton (usually). The terrain in unit 62 is mild (in my view) lots of flat mesas with deep canyons. Lots of roads and trails too although the forest service has been shutting lots of roads down (gates). It's definitely elk country but like your subject say's "with the orange army" is pretty accurate.
